Web@nauticalnico ay-oh-win. 18 Jan 2024 Cistern water systems vary in cost. How much you spend depends mainly on how large a reservoir tank you need. Other factors include installation fees, pump and pipe requirements and filtration systems. For cistern tanks with enough capacity to supply residential water systems, expect to pay from $3,000 to $10,000, … See more A cistern is a container for collecting and storing water. It can be large or small, underground or above-ground, and frequently supplied by a well, spring or rainwater. Most often used for irrigation, some cistern water … See more Cistern water systems for domestic use work like this: Water from an outside source collects in the cistern before being piped into the household water system. This transfer can … See more The main difference between a cistern water system and a well is that a cistern stores water from an external source, and a well itself is a water source.
